I usually make this in a crockpot, but, I didn’t get the stuff to make it in time, so I used my Dutch Oven. I have a great homemade sauce, but, i was in a hurry so I just used Prego.. 1-Pkg. Johnsonville Italian Sausage Links 1-1/2 lbs. Lean Ground Beef Diced White Onions Diced Garlic Diced Green Peppers 1-Pkg. Sliced Fresh Mushrooms 3 Jars Prego Italian Sausage & Garlic Garlic Salt/Black Pepper ****I Sprinkled Some Garlic Salt & Black Pepper On The Hamburger While It Was Frying & Added Some To The Dutch Oven Mixture. Fettuccini Slice Johnsonville Italian Sausage Links into thick chunks. Melt some butter in a skillet and cook the Italian Sausage Links until done. Put links in a plate and pat the grease off with a paper towel. While the Sausage Links are frying, fry the hamburger in skillet: drain grease if there is any. I used lean ground hamburger so there wasn’t any. I patted it with a paper towel though just to make sure. Add the Sausage Links, hamburger and the veggies and Prego to a Dutch Oven; stir. Cook on low until heated through. I cooked it on low for a couple of hours probably. Cook Fettuccini: according to directions. Plate Fettuccini and pour sauce over. Sprinkle Parmesan Cheese and Red Pepper Flakes over-(opt.) Served with a salad and garlic bread, Quote Link to comment
